Psychiatry has come up as one of the most dynamic branches of medicine in recent years. In recent years the scope of Psychiatry has enlarged considerably with wide ranging influences from Sociology, Anthropology and Philosophy on the one hand and Neurology and Medicine on other hand. Mental Health issues are often stigmatised in India, leading to many not seeking help. “Our National Mental Health Survey, 2016 found that close to 14 percent of India’s population required active mental health interventions. So it is causing lot of burden not only on the individual but also on the family and society. Community is in dire need of Psychiatrists with Holistic Perspective.

Psychiatry is the branch of medicine that deals with the causation, prevention, diagnosis and treatment of mental and behavioural disorders. It also deals with rehabilitation. It takes into account the biological, psychological and social/cultural perspectives of the disease.

Activities in the Department Of Psychiatry:

  • PG students are posted to the INSTITUTE OF MENTAL HEALTH (IMH) Erragadda for Training (a government teaching hospital for allopathic post graduates) and they are also posted to NIMH (National Institute of Mental Health), Bowenpally for clinical training.
  • Visit to various National wide Institutes of Mental Health like NHRIMH (National Homoeopathic Research Institute of Mental Health, Kottayam, Kerala).
  • The students are provided with audio-visual equipment like an LCD projector for teaching and presentations. They also have numerous structured discussions, seminars, clinical meetings and journal clubs.
  • They have general and departmental libraries through which they have wide range of national and international journals and various national and international books on Psychiatry.
  • The students are also exposed to the specialists in the field to improve their knowledge. The department encourages students to participate in state level, national and international level conferences and seminars.
  • PG students also has teaching programme in the subject of Psychiatry for final year UG students.
  • PG students have daily clinical exposure in IPD (In patient Department) and OPD (Out Patients Department).
  • Detailed study on mind rubrics in various repertories and other books.
  • Psychiatric Disorders like Generalized Anxiety Disorder, Panic Disorder, Social Anxiety Disorder, Mood Disorders(Depression, Bipolar), Posttraumatic stress disorder, Obsessive Compulsive Disorder, Alcohol Use Disorder, Substance Abuse like Cannabis, Delusion Disorder, Conduct Disorder, Autism Spectrum Disorder, ADHD in children, Learning Disorders, Sexual Disorders, Schizophrenia, Insomnia, Dementia, Phobic Disorders etc., are common in our OPD.
  • Psychiatrists ideally evaluate patients from a biopsychosocial perspective before prescribing the treatment. Various improved methods of prescribing along with counselling (psychotherapy) will be taught.
